On Mon, Apr 26, 2010 at 7:24 AM, Douglas Wagner <douglasw0 at gmail.com> wrote:
> Handbrake is working just fine in a Command Line format, seems a bit slow (2
> hours of encoding for a 1 hour video) but I won't complain, time isn't my
> concern at this point.  We'll see how the final video turns out before I
> pass judgment however.

That's pretty slow for the iPod preset - encoding on a Core 2 E7400
(dual core at 2.80Ghz) I average a little over 70 frames per second.
That scales roughly linearly with clockspeed within the Core 2 line -
the E4500 (2.2Ghz dual) in my frontend manages around 50 fps. That
drops to about 30 fps on a 5 year old dual core Athlon whose specs I
can't recall, and to about 20 fps on my ancient Pentium 4 (3.0Ghz
single core) backend.

My point is, I would have expected realtiime or better for that preset
on modern hardware.
